CT6 8UQ is a mixed residential area on Fernlea Avenue, 0.6km from Herne Bay in Herne Bay. Administratively it sits within Heron ward and the North Thanet const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in CT6, CT6 8UQ offers a well-established suburb with a mixed age range and strong community feel. The 49 average age signals a mature family neighbourhood — long-term residents, good local schools, and high levels of owner-occupation. 83%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ime is moderate at 63 incidents per 1,000 residents — broadly typical for this type of urban area. Property: Prices average £415k.

Census 2021 statistics for CT6 8UQ are sourced from Output Area E00122274 (shared with 9 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
